About this role:

This role acts as the primary advisor for the AMER – East/EMEA sales team, managing all aspects of contract and deal management. Key responsibilities include ensuring timely and accurate Order Forms, maintaining Salesforce data hygiene, obtaining approvals for pricing and payment terms, processing amendments, and supporting the sales team in structuring fully approved deals.

The Deal Desk role plays a critical, cross-functional role in optimizing the sales cycle, ensuring compliance, and supporting strategic growth. This position demands a blend of operational efficiency, advisory capabilities, and a commitment to continuous process improvement.

Key Resposibilities

  • Order-to-Cash Cycle Management: Thoroughly review, process, and validate all incoming Order Forms, Sales Support requests, and Bookings to ensure accuracy, completeness, and adherence to company policies and pricing structures. This includes verifying customer details, product configurations, contractual terms and any non-standard terms.
  • Service Level Agreement (SLA) Adherence: Diligently monitor and meet all established process Service Level Agreements (SLAs) for deal review and booking, maintaining a consistent flow in the sales pipeline and ensuring a positive experience for both the sales team and internal stakeholders.
  • Documentation and Policy Governance: Maintain, coordinate, and actively participate in the drafting and regular updating of our internal Deal Desk guides, policies, and procedural documentation. This documentation must accurately reflect current best practices related to deal processing, booking logic, and internal compliance standards.
  • System Implementation and Optimization: Actively assist the team with the configuration, testing, and rollout of critical tools, including a CPQ system, ensuring it meets the evolving needs of the sales organization and integrates smoothly with other enterprise systems.
  • Project Leadership and Analytical Support: Execute and assist on all internal strategic initiatives aimed at improving sales efficiency and financial integrity. Provide essential support on additional projects and conduct detailed analysis as needed to inform decision-making regarding pricing, discounting, and deal structure.
  • Trusted Deal Advisor: Serve as a primary point of contact and trusted advisor to the Sales, Legal, and Finance teams, offering expert guidance on complex deal-related questions, booking requirements, revenue recognition impacts, and established internal processes. Facilitate communication to expedite deal closure while maintaining compliance.
  • Sales Training and Enablement: Assist in sales training and enablement sessions focused on quoting procedures, pricing policies, and mandatory process requirements. This ensures the sales organization is proficient in utilizing quoting tools and adhering to our booking policy.
  • Process Improvement and Collaboration: Proactively collaborate with other internal stakeholders, including Finance, Revenue Operations, and IT, to continuously review and refine existing processes, aiming for maximum efficiency, scalability, and compliance with all internal and external regulations (SOX).
  • Ad-Hoc Duties: Perform additional duties, analyses, and administrative tasks as assigned by management to support the broader operational and strategic objectives of the Deal Desk teams.

Experience

  • A minimum of 3-5 years of experience in Deal Desk or Sales Operations within a SaaS environment, including expertise in contract review, compliance review and/or drafting, and a solid understanding of negotiation strategy.
  • Demonstrated ability to thrive in a high-velocity, fast-paced professional environment.
  • Proficiency with CPQ systems and experience with CPQ implementation processes.
  • Exceptional organizational capabilities and proven effective communication skills, both verbal and written.
  • Salesforce Systems Administrator experience a plus
  • Familiarity with pertinent software applications, including Salesforce (SFDC), Ironclad, DocuSign, Microsoft Word, Excel, PDF management tools, and the Google Suite.

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
